Giving back to the community
is at the core of Whiz Kids Toys’
mission year-round, through direct
donations to schools and local
youth initiatives. Smith notes that
“as a locally-owned small business,
it’s always been a priority and a
pleasure to support the children
and families in our community
and bring positivity and play to our
neighbors whenever possible.” Dur-
ing the holidays, Whiz Kids Toys
hosts its Annual Angel Tree Project
to help make the holiday season
festive for children, often working
with local charities, including Preg-
nancy & Parenting Support of SLO
and Jack’s Helping Hands, as well as
local elementary schools.
